The red wine St. Henri Shiraz, vintage 2007 from the winery Penfolds has been rated in 2013 with 93 Falstaff points. It is a wine made from the grape variety Syrah from the region South Australia in Australia.
Tasting Notes
Deep dark ruby garnet, opaque core, violet reflections, watery rim. Fine nougat, delicate dried fruit, fine raisins, sweet spice notes, candied orange zest. Rich, complex, chocolaty nuances, present wood spice, delicate hints of eucalyptus, mineral-salty, lingers well, balanced, storable style.
